Penina Biddle-Gottesman (Penny Anne) is a Bay Area-based audio engineer, producer, professional vocalist, film composer, instrument designer, performer, music teacher, and recent Oberlin Conservatory graduate with a major in Technology in Music and Related Arts. In 2026 she was a spring intern at WAM (Women’s Audio Mission), where she received her AVID Pro Tools certification and completed both levels of WAM academy. As an engineer she has worked on a wide range of genres, including pop, rock, soul, folk classical, and experimental sound art. She loves to take on projects that blend musical conventions and resist easy genre classification. During her time at Different Fur, she has recorded and/or mixed for a wide range of musicians, including Bobby McFerrin, Starfish Prime, Isabelle Waldner Kalb, Max Simas, Zen Williams, and Stuart James Allison, and has assisted on sessions for Spiritual Cramp, Buddy Jr, Christina’s Trip, Ketam, and Barry Walters.
She has scored films for Jonah Belsky, Piper Morrison, Sarah Rosenthal, ArVejon Jones, and Charlie Sortino. She has also composed and performed music for two Marin Theatre Company productions: Mother of the Maid (2019), and Dunsinane (2022). Her theatrical compositions were reviewed favorably in the San Francisco Chronicle. Penny began studying engineering and production on Logic Pro in high school as a DIY recording artist with just a Scarlett 2i2 and an SM57.
In college she continued developing her mixing and recording skills, working on music from her peers as well as her own. She worked as a promoter and booker at the Dionsysus Discotheque, a live sound engineer for Oberlin’s Modern Music Guild, an electrical engineering assistant at Dogbotic Labs, and a choral scholar at the Christ Episcopal Church. In 2024 Penny recieved the Allen Strange Memorial Award from SEAMUS (the Society of Electro Acoustic Music of the United States) for a collaborative wearable instrument “String Thing” she built with her collaborator Fae Ordaz. The two were also selected to perform in Oberlin Conservatory’s Danenburg Honors Recital Series. She and Ordaz have toured across the country, performing at academic conferences, universities, arts festivals, radio shows, DIY venues, and basements. Penny releases experimental pop music under the name Penny Anne, and performs regularly as a soloist and with her band Duty Free.
